| contents | We developed two new alternatives to signature-based, spatial autoregressive models. In a simulation study, we found that the new models performed at least as well as existing approaches but presented shorter computation times. We then used the new models to analyze the premature mortality rate and the mortality rate for people aged 65 and over. |
